    Ribs are generally absent, so the lungs are filled by buccal pumping and a frog deprived of its lungs can maintain its body functions without them. [69] The fully aquatic Bornean flat-headed frog (Barbourula kalimantanensis) is the first frog known to lack lungs entirely. [72] Frogs have three-chambered hearts, a feature they share with lizards.

    Some freshwater pulmonates keep a bubble of air inside the shell, which helps them to float. [1] Many of the very small freshwater limpets which live in cold water have lost the ability to breathe air, and instead flood their mantle cavity with water. [1] Oxygen diffuses from the water to the snail's body directly. [1]

    Cutaneous respiration in frogs and other amphibians may be the primary respiratory mode during colder temperatures. [3] Some amphibians utilizing cutaneous respiration have extensive folds of skin to increase the rate of respiration. Examples include the hellbender salamander and the Lake Titicaca water frog. [2]
